量化交易系统可通过多种计算机语言来编写,而Python作为当下最流行的计算机语言,其使用率在多种语言中位居第一。
Python是一种跨平台兼容的高级编程语言,开源环境拥有多个专有的专业库函数,比如:
Scipy、numpy、pandas、matplotlib、quantopian、Zipline、TA-Lib、Pybacktest等可快速开发无障碍量化交易策略。
Tensorflow、seaborn、scikit learn、Keras、plotly、stats可帮助交易模型进行更有效的数据挖掘和交易执行。
SpyderIDE优化了交易模型中的数据可视化,使财务分析变得更直观简易。
PyAlgoTrade作为Python独家算法交易库函数,专注于纸面交易、回溯测试、实时交易和技术分析,带来更高效的量化交易。
使用Python作为计算机语言来编写交易模型和所有量化交易模型制定过程一样,由策略识别、策略回测、执行系统和风险管理构成。
但Python的优点在于,在所有过程中,其计算机语言更易懂,逻辑排序更有条理性,并且提供多个独家库函数可直接调用。
在策略识别阶段,可根据自身需要的交易特点来调用多个库函数,来编写更适合自己的交易策略。
策略回测阶段,专业的库函数可进行更全面的数据回测,以获得更准确的回测结果,保证前期编写的交易模型更有效力。
执行系统方面,因为语言逻辑的清晰性,使模型执行时出现BUG的概率大为降低,不错过任何投资获益点。
风险管理过程中,因为语言清晰,所以很容易找到调整点,进行数据细微调整来控制必须的风险管理,而不影响整个交易模型的完整运行。
Python是一种跨平台兼容的高级编程语言,开源环境拥有多个专有的专业库函数,比如:
Scipy、numpy、pandas、matplotlib、quantopian、Zipline、TA-Lib、Pybacktest等可快速开发无障碍量化交易策略。
Tensorflow、seaborn、scikit learn、Keras、plotly、stats可帮助交易模型进行更有效的数据挖掘和交易执行。
SpyderIDE优化了交易模型中的数据可视化,使财务分析变得更直观简易。
PyAlgoTrade作为Python独家算法交易库函数,专注于纸面交易、回溯测试、实时交易和技术分析,带来更高效的量化交易。
使用Python作为计算机语言来编写交易模型和所有量化交易模型制定过程一样,由策略识别、策略回测、执行系统和风险管理构成。
但Python的优点在于,在所有过程中,其计算机语言更易懂,逻辑排序更有条理性,并且提供多个独家库函数可直接调用。
在策略识别阶段,可根据自身需要的交易特点来调用多个库函数,来编写更适合自己的交易策略。
策略回测阶段,专业的库函数可进行更全面的数据回测,以获得更准确的回测结果,保证前期编写的交易模型更有效力。
执行系统方面,因为语言逻辑的清晰性,使模型执行时出现BUG的概率大为降低,不错过任何投资获益点。
风险管理过程中,因为语言清晰,所以很容易找到调整点,进行数据细微调整来控制必须的风险管理,而不影响整个交易模型的完整运行。